24. Mix Different Prints
Leopard print is one of the biggest trends of the season. Wearing a leopard scarf is a subtle way to try out the trend without having to wear leopard from head to toe.
Follow these 5 guidelines to learn how I mix prints in my outfits, and how you can too!
1. Choose 2 patterns to mix
When it comes to mixing patterns, I like sticking with two different patterns. Anything more than two patterns gets a little too busy looking in my opinion. You want your pattern mixing to look purposeful, not like you got dressed in the dark 🙂
I’ve always been a huge fan of mixing stripes and animal prints together for a cute fall outfit. This is an easy combo to try out for a pattern mixing beginner!
2. Stick with a color scheme
When I’m mixing two patterns together, I want to make sure that the color scheme of the whole outfit is going to be cohesive, so with my outfit pictured above, I stuck with a black, white and tan theme.
3. Mix materials, too!
Another fun way to mix up an outfit is by choosing different materials to pair together, so I wore a leather jacket with suede booties. I wouldn’t have worn leather boots with a leather jacket because I like to diversify my materials as well as patterns.
4. Don’t directly layer the prints
I personally don’t like layering my prints on top of each other. I wouldn’t wear a striped top with a cheetah print jacket on top. I always make sure my patterns aren’t directly layered on top of each other. I wore a leather jacket to break up the striped top and animal printed scarf.
5. Play around with your prints
There is not just one way to mix prints, and there are no hard-set rules on how to do it. I wanted to share with you the guidelines that I follow when styling multiple prints. Play around with the clothes you have and see what looks best on you and what you feel the most confident in!

How to Style Fall Outfits
Fall is my favorite season because there’s nothing I love more than styling fall outfits. I love the layers, textures, colors, and trends that come along with fall, and that is what makes it so fun for me! If you have any questions about styling fall outfits or if it’s not so fun for you, I am going to help you out and make it fun and exciting for you.
First things first, what makes dressing for fall so fun (for me) is all of the layerings and accessorizing that goes on. I love layering sweaters over dresses or tops, wearing hats, boots, scarves, etc! You don’t always have to hide your cute outfit with a coat, you can layer and stay warm by adding pieces like sweaters, moto jackets, a hat, scarf, etc. to keep you warm and looking very stylish. Layering doesn’t need to be complicated, so make sure you keep it simple!
Example of a sweater over a dress with boots and a hat.
One of my favorite ways to layer in the fall is by wearing a sweater dress with a long cardigan or leather jacket over it and adding some OTK boots or booties to the look. If it’s extra chilly that day, make sure you layer on a scarf and even a floppy felt hat or a knitted beanie. As the weather changes throughout the day, you can simply remove items you no longer need (i.e. hat, scarf, or sweater). Playing around with layering is FUN because you can create several different outfits by wearing the same basic pieces and just changing a few of the layering details.
